在发育过程中强度的性别差异:对体育中的包容性和公平性的影响

概括
男孩比女孩更强壮,但肌肉大小和力量在童年期间在两性同样增加. 这表明早期的力量差异可能不是由激素驱动的. 需要进一步的研究.

背景情况:
- 男人通常表现出比女性更大的肌肉大小和力量,这通常归因于青春期的荷尔蒙变化.
- 然而,对激素对肌肉功能早期发育差异的影响的证据尚未确定.
- 研究在青春期前肌肉成分的基于性别的变化对于理解这些差异至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 为了检查男孩和女孩之间的前臂肌肉大小和力量的早期生活变化.
- 为了确定肌肉功能的性别差异是否在青春期之前出现.
- 为了将肌肉大小的变化与随时间变化的力量相关联.
主要方法:
- 一项涉及51名儿童 (29名男孩,22名女孩) 的纵向研究,评估时间约为三年 (2021-2023年).
- 测量包括前臂肌肉大小 (腰部肌肉厚度) 和手握强度.
- 统计分析的重点是性别与时间的相互作用,性别和时间的主要影响,以及肌肉大小和力量之间的相关性.
主要成果:
- 所有儿童的肌肉大小和力量都随着年龄的增长而显著增加.
- 男孩表现出比女孩更强的握手力,这与最初的测量有所不同.
- 随着时间的推移,肌肉大小增加的速度没有发现基于性别的显著差异.
- 在整个研究期间,在参与者的肌肉大小和力量之间观察到强烈的正相关性.
结论:
- 肌肉的大小和力量在童年期间并行增加,变化速度没有性别特异.
- 观察到的强度的性别差异似乎是在生命早期建立起来的,在青春期显著的荷尔蒙影响之前.
- 需要进一步调查,以阐明导致最大强度最初基于性别的差异的潜在因素.
